
Category: Photos


Union Station in Montgomery, Ala.
The station now houses the city’s visitors center. I highly
View post
Kress retail store in Montgomery, Ala.
More photos from Montgomery, Alabama’s, Kress on Dexter development. The
View post
Today’s rocket launch
A new GPS satellite was launched this morning from Cape
View post